Job Summary
The main purpose of the position is to support the implementation of a non-formal education programme in Akkar, Tripoli/T5 district, for Syrian refugee and vulnerable Lebanese children. The Education Field Officer will be responsible to carry out field assessments, monitoring the progress of the projects activities and be the key focal point for the teachers/facilitators, students, caregiver and community groups. Ensuring full inclusion of the most vulnerable children and families is a key responsibility of this role. The role will be based within the Concern Halba office, but will travel frequently to the project sites to meet with the projects teachers, caregiver and community groups, and other stakeholders.
Duties and Responsibilities
Participate in information gathering and assessments.
a) Carry out site mapping exercises to determine the class locations based on population size, education needs, access to formal education and land availability.
b) Carry out education service mapping of both formal and non-formal services for information sharing and referrals with the projects beneficiaries.
c) Participate in additional information gathering and assessments as required.
Monitor field level implementation of non-formal education (NFE).
a) Monitor the qualitative and quantitative delivery of NFE classes, such as student progress appraisals, teaching methods, attendance rates, assets management, etc.
b) Ensure adherence by NFE teachers to the standard operating procedures and codes of conduct.
c) Conduct regular coordination meetings with NFE teachers, Syrian refugee caregivers and community representative groups to identify activity progress, successes and areas for improvement.
d) Train teachers/facilitators and supervise their development
Reporting and information management
a) Prepare weekly reports on qualitative and quantitative data against project indicators.
b) Responsible for field level documentation, such as attendance sheets, teacher feedback forms and community meeting minutes. Monitor the correct usage of documentation, and support to fill gaps as needed.
c) Data entry into project database
Quality and accountability
a) Adhere to the standards of conduct outlined in the Programme Participant Protection Policy and Concern Code of Conduct.
b) Support and promote the standards outlined in the Programme Participant Protection Policy and Concern Code of Conduct to the team, partner organisations and beneficiaries, and be committed to providing a safe working environment.
c) To contribute to the establishment of preventive measures to reduce the potential for abuse in Concern programme (as per P4 section 4.a)
d) Work with the Education Project Manager and Programme Manager, NFE facilitators/teachers and stakeholders to ensure quality delivery of NFE, in a protective environment.
e) Collect feedback from beneficiaries to adjust programming to meet the needs of the community using Concern’s Complaint Response Mechanism.
f) Report any case of child labour observed on site to the Protection team using Concern’s referral form.
